1. Sort (top-load/front-load)
Washer kind considerably influences general weight. Entrance-load washers usually weigh greater than top-load machines of comparable capability. This weight distinction stems from a number of components. Entrance-load washers require extra strong development to help the horizontal drum’s spinning motion and mitigate vibrations. They usually incorporate heavier elements, resembling concrete or cast-iron counterweights, to reinforce stability throughout high-speed spin cycles. Prime-load machines, with their vertically oriented drums, require much less complicated stabilization mechanisms, leading to a lighter general construction. As an illustration, a typical capability front-load washer would possibly weigh between 170 and 210 kilos, whereas an analogous top-load mannequin would possibly weigh between 130 and 170 kilos.
This weight disparity has sensible implications for set up and motion. Entrance-load washers, because of their better mass, could necessitate strengthened flooring, notably on higher ranges. Transferring these home equipment requires extra effort and probably specialised tools like equipment dollies. Prime-load machines, being lighter, current fewer challenges in these areas, usually requiring much less specialised tools or help throughout transport and set up. 2. Capability (cubic ft)
Washer capability, measured in cubic ft, instantly correlates with the equipment’s weight. Bigger capability machines accommodate better volumes of laundry, necessitating bigger drums, stronger motors, and extra strong inner elements. This improve in measurement and structural reinforcement interprets to the next general weight. Understanding this relationship is essential for choosing an acceptable equipment for obtainable house and making certain protected dealing with and set up.
-
Compact Capability (2.0 – 2.5 cubic ft)
Compact washers, sometimes starting from 2.0 to 2.5 cubic ft, provide smaller footprints and lighter weights, making them supreme for flats or restricted areas. Their diminished capability requires much less strong development, leading to weights sometimes underneath 100 kilos. This lighter weight facilitates simpler maneuverability and set up, usually with out specialised tools.
-
Customary Capability (3.0 – 4.5 cubic ft)
Customary capability washers, falling throughout the 3.0 to 4.5 cubic ft vary, cater to the wants of common households. This capability improve necessitates bigger drums and extra highly effective motors, leading to weights starting from 130 to over 200 kilos. The load variation inside this class usually is determined by the washer kind (top-load or front-load) and extra options.
-
Giant Capability (4.5+ cubic ft)
Giant capability washers, exceeding 4.5 cubic ft, accommodate bigger households or frequent laundry wants. These machines require substantial inner elements and strong development to handle heavier masses, leading to weights usually exceeding 200 kilos. Such weights necessitate cautious consideration of flooring help and specialised tools for transport and set up.

3. Building Supplies
Building supplies play a big function in figuring out a washer’s weight. The selection of supplies impacts not solely the machine’s general mass but additionally its sturdiness, longevity, and resistance to put on and tear. Totally different elements make the most of particular supplies chosen for his or her properties and contribution to the equipment’s performance and weight.
The outer cupboard, usually constructed from metal or porcelain-enameled metal, contributes considerably to the general weight. Metal gives sturdiness and resistance to wreck, however its density provides to the machine’s mass. Internal elements, such because the drum, additionally affect weight. Stainless-steel drums, whereas proof against rust and corrosion, are heavier than plastic or porcelain-coated metal alternate options. Using concrete or cast-iron counterweights for stability throughout high-speed spin cycles additional provides to the general weight, particularly in front-load machines. For instance, a washer with a stainless-steel drum will sometimes weigh greater than a comparable mannequin with a porcelain-enameled metal drum. Equally, machines using concrete counterweights might be heavier than these with lighter balancing mechanisms. 7. Transportable vs. commonplace
The excellence between moveable and commonplace washing machines considerably impacts their weight. Transportable washers, designed for compact areas and straightforward mobility, prioritize lighter development. Customary washers, meant for everlasting set up, usually incorporate heavier supplies and bigger capacities. This elementary design distinction leads to a considerable weight disparity between the 2 varieties. Transportable washers sometimes weigh between 40 and 80 kilos, facilitating simple transport and storage. Customary washers, conversely, can vary from 130 to over 200 kilos, necessitating extra strong dealing with procedures and probably specialised tools for motion. This distinction stems from the core design ideas: portability necessitates minimized weight, whereas commonplace fashions prioritize capability and sturdiness, usually using heavier elements like chrome steel drums and concrete counterweights.

Ideas for Dealing with Washing Machine Weight
Correct dealing with of a washer, given its substantial weight, is essential for stopping accidents and property injury. The following pointers provide sensible steerage for protected and environment friendly equipment motion and set up, minimizing dangers related to improper dealing with.
Tip 1: Seek the advice of Producer Specs: Confirm the exact weight of the precise mannequin earlier than making an attempt any motion or set up. This data informs acceptable tools choice and dealing with procedures.
Tip 2: Make the most of Applicable Transferring Gear: Make use of equipment dollies or hand vehicles particularly designed for heavy home equipment. Keep away from utilizing makeshift options or making an attempt to raise the machine with out correct tools. Equipment dollies with rubber wheels and safe straps decrease the danger of harm to flooring and supply better management throughout motion.
Tip 3: Enlist Help: Given the appreciable weight of most washing machines, enlisting the assistance of one other individual is extremely beneficial. Two people can distribute the burden extra evenly, lowering pressure and enhancing management throughout lifting and maneuvering. Clear communication between lifters is important for coordinated motion and stopping accidents.
Tip 4: Clear the Path: Guarantee a transparent and unobstructed path from the equipment’s present location to its vacation spot. Take away obstacles, safe unfastened rugs, and defend doorways and partitions to forestall injury throughout transport. Measuring doorways and hallways prematurely ensures the equipment can go by with out issue.
Tip 5: Safe the Machine: Safe the washer to the dolly or hand truck utilizing straps or ropes to forestall shifting or tipping throughout motion. Correctly secured home equipment decrease the danger of accidents and injury throughout transport, particularly over uneven surfaces or inclines.
Tip 6: Elevate with Correct Approach: When lifting, preserve a straight again and bend on the knees, using leg muscle tissue fairly than again muscle tissue to keep away from pressure or damage. Keep away from twisting or jerking motions throughout lifting, as these can exacerbate pressure and improve the danger of damage.
Tip 7: Contemplate Ground Reinforcement: For upper-level installations, assess flooring load-bearing capability and think about reinforcement if obligatory. Consulting a structural engineer can present knowledgeable steerage concerning acceptable reinforcement strategies to make sure long-term stability and stop flooring injury.
Tip 8: Disconnect and Drain Earlier than Transferring: Disconnect all water and energy connections earlier than transferring the equipment. Drain any remaining water to attenuate weight and stop leaks throughout transport. This precautionary measure prevents electrical hazards and water injury throughout equipment relocation.
